类 SubmitJobOperation
- java.lang.Object
-
- com.hazelcast.spi.impl.operationservice.Operation
-
- org.apache.seatunnel.engine.server.operation.AsyncOperation
-
- org.apache.seatunnel.engine.server.operation.AbstractJobAsyncOperation
-
- org.apache.seatunnel.engine.server.operation.SubmitJobOperation
-
- 所有已实现的接口:
com.hazelcast.nio.serialization.DataSerializable,com.hazelcast.nio.serialization.IdentifiedDataSerializable,com.hazelcast.spi.tenantcontrol.Tenantable
public class SubmitJobOperation extends AbstractJobAsyncOperation
-
-
字段概要
-
从类继承的字段 org.apache.seatunnel.engine.server.operation.AbstractJobAsyncOperation
jobId
-
-
构造器概要
构造器 构造器 说明 SubmitJobOperation()SubmitJobOperation(long jobId, @NonNull com.hazelcast.internal.serialization.Data jobImmutableInformation, boolean isStartWithSavePoint)
-
方法概要
所有方法 实例方法 具体方法 修饰符和类型 方法 说明 protected org.apache.seatunnel.engine.common.utils.PassiveCompletableFuture<?>doRun()intgetClassId()protected voidreadInternal(com.hazelcast.nio.ObjectDataInput in)protected voidwriteInternal(com.hazelcast.nio.ObjectDataOutput out)-
从类继承的方法 org.apache.seatunnel.engine.server.operation.AsyncOperation
beforeRun, getFactoryId, getResponse, onInvocationException, returnsResponse, run
-
从类继承的方法 com.hazelcast.spi.impl.operationservice.Operation
afterRun, afterRunFinal, call, clearThreadContext, executedLocally, getCallerAddress, getCallerUuid, getCallId, getCallTimeout, getClientCallId, getConnection, getInvocationTime, getLogger, getNodeEngine, getOperationResponseHandler, getPartitionId, getReplicaIndex, getService, getServiceName, getTenantControl, getTenantControlOrNoop, getWaitTimeout, isTenantAvailable, isUrgent, logError, onExecutionFailure, onSetCallId, popThreadContext, pushThreadContext, readData, requiresExplicitServiceName, requiresTenantContext, sendResponse, setCallerUuid, setClientCallId, setNodeEngine, setOperationResponseHandler, setPartitionId, setReplicaIndex, setService, setServiceName, setValidateTarget, setWaitTimeout, toString, toString, validatesTarget, writeData
-
-
-
-
方法详细资料
-
getClassId
public int getClassId()
-
writeInternal
protected void writeInternal(com.hazelcast.nio.ObjectDataOutput out) throws IOException- 覆盖:
writeInternal在类中AbstractJobAsyncOperation- 抛出:
IOException
-
readInternal
protected void readInternal(com.hazelcast.nio.ObjectDataInput in) throws IOException- 覆盖:
readInternal在类中AbstractJobAsyncOperation- 抛出:
IOException
-
doRun
protected org.apache.seatunnel.engine.common.utils.PassiveCompletableFuture<?> doRun() throws Exception- 指定者:
doRun在类中AsyncOperation- 抛出:
Exception
-
-